About the area Situated in Tignes le Lac, the hotel occupies a central position within the resort. At an altitude of 2,100 meters, Tignes is one of the highest villages in the Alps, ensuring fresh air and dramatic vistas. The location provides immediate access to local shops and the picturesque mountain lake, which is the focal point of the town during the summer months.
Travelers arriving from major European hubs typically transit through Geneva or Lyon. Nearby Jewish landmarks Tignes is a premier destination for those who appreciate the outdoors. While many associate the area with winter sports, the summer season transforms the landscape into a playground for hikers, mountain bikers, and nature enthusiasts. The Vanoise National Park is nearby, offering miles of protected trails and opportunities to view local flora and fauna.
For those interested in local Jewish history, the broader Savoie region and nearby cities like Chambéry or Grenoble have established communities and historical sites. Guests can visit the Tignes Lake for paddleboarding or kayaking, or take the Palafour chairlift to enjoy panoramic views of the Alps. The surrounding mountains offer a variety of difficulty levels for trekking, ensuring that both casual walkers and serious mountaineers have options during their stay.
